125 bottles of cough syrup seized in Silchar

Special Correspondent

SILCHAR: Smuggling of contraband goods is a routine affair through the corridor of Barak Valley. Most of these goods are taken to Bangladesh, taking advantage of the astray holes in border fencing. Often smugglers are caught and subjected to penal measures. Sometime, they give a slip also as it happened on Friday at Silchar railway station.

According to Mrinal Mondal, station master, during routine check of the Silchar-Agartala passenger train around 8 am, RPF team led by head constable RB Das found cartons of banned cough syrup, totaling 125 bottles in a compartment and seized them. Apprehending the RPF team would swoop on them, the smugglers maintain a distance inside the compartment made their escape good. It is suspected that the smugglers are from Tripura and the cough syrup bottles were meant for smuggling them out to Bangldaesh where they are in great demand.
